Friends, friends… Business aside! Even though it helps Amanda nunes in adjusting grappling to combat against Julianna Pena No. UFC 269 on December 11th, Kayla harrison made a controversial statement. Free on the market, the North American tried to highlight her appreciation for the Brazilian, but does not rule out facing her in the near future.

“I love Amanda (Nunes) and I think she’s incredible. I don't want to piss off our teammates and coaches, but I'm at that point in my life where I know my worth and I want to see what happens. The best compliment I can give is that I want to fight Amanda. I want to fight, but then go out to eat with her, without rivalry” said Harrison, in an interview with 'MMA Junkie'.

With respect, Kayla still doesn't know if she will, in fact, sign a contract with Ultimate. Still, the two-time Olympic champion stated that Amanda is the 'best in history' and has a lot of respect for the 'Lioness'.

“There’s nothing I wouldn’t do for a teammate and I don’t do it out of spite. But it's just business, you know? It's an honor to be mentioned in the same sentence as her. Amanda is the greatest of all time for a reason, and I put a lot of respect into that name, and I don't call people the greatest of all time for nothing,” she concluded.

Kayla harrison, 31 years old, has a 'perfect record' in MMA. Professional since 2018, he has 11 consecutive victories in his career. She became known in martial arts after winning two Olympic gold medals, competing in judo. His first came in 2012, in London, and the second, in Rio de Janeiro, in 2016.
